Portrait of Boredom Among Athletes and Its Implications in Sports Management: A Multi-Method Approach
Abstract
There is a common misconception that elite athletes enjoy their sports activities so much that they cannot feel bored. However, this research reveals that boredom is a prevalent emotion among professional, amateur, and college athletes that impacts their performance, brand preferences, and over consumption behaviors. This investigation relies on a multi-method approach. Qualitative data were collected through interviewing athletes (n=123), and...
